About the work

I've been designing and leading interface development projects since 2000. My designs often come out very different from one another, I think this is because I see design as situational. The design process for me begins on paper, then it progresses into Photoshop, Illustrator or Flash before being hand-coded into xhtml and css. Once the code has been validated and looks good in Browsercam, I generally use a CMS of some sort - my preference being Expression Engine (which this site proudly runs on) although Wordpress, TextPattern, and Typo3 are familiar to me. Many of the projects shown here were done in the "design for community and learning" space but over the past year I've yearned to extend my work into the realm of entertainment and e-commerce.
